From 1bcc20d7c3523dfddc34a44881048824f3b86d1c Mon Sep 17 00:00:00 2001 From: Mark Cowlishaw Date: Wed, 21 Aug 2019 19:39:12 -0700 Subject: [PATCH 1/5] Add blockchain to latest profile --- profiles/definitions/latest-2019-04-30.md | 9 +++++++++ 1 file changed, 9 insertions(+) diff --git a/profiles/definitions/latest-2019-04-30.md b/profiles/definitions/latest-2019-04-30.md index d232011ad030..c011a4cc041a 100644 --- a/profiles/definitions/latest-2019-04-30.md +++ b/profiles/definitions/latest-2019-04-30.md @@ -41,6 +41,15 @@ profiles: - managedClusters/accessProfiles '2017-07-01': - containerServices + microsoft.blockchain: + '2018-06-01-preview': + - blockchainMembers + - blockchainMembers/consortiumMembers + - blockchainMembers/transactionNodes + - locations + - locations/blockchainMemberOperationResults + - operations + - skus microsoft.capacity: '2019-04-01': - appliedReservations From 7b4609776da798ad54384cbaccd1221f096b275b Mon Sep 17 00:00:00 2001 From: Mark Cowlishaw Date: Wed, 21 Aug 2019 19:52:35 -0700 Subject: [PATCH 2/5] Add additional types --- profiles/definitions/latest-2019-04-30.md |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/profiles/definitions/latest-2019-04-30.md b/profiles/definitions/latest-2019-04-30.md index c011a4cc041a..5a4f50360390 100644 --- a/profiles/definitions/latest-2019-04-30.md +++ b/profiles/definitions/latest-2019-04-30.md @@ -45,9 +45,15 @@ profiles: '2018-06-01-preview': - blockchainMembers - blockchainMembers/consortiumMembers + - blockchainMembers/listApiKeys + - lockchainMembers/regenerateApiKeys - blockchainMembers/transactionNodes + - blockchainMembers/transactionNodes/listApiKeys + - blockchainMembers/transactionNodes/regenerateApiKeys - locations - locations/blockchainMemberOperationResults + - locations/checkNameAvailability + - locations/listConsortiums - operations - skus microsoft.capacity: From 6a3219f28bcb6091276d37dec29cdda6fe3584c7 Mon Sep 17 00:00:00 2001 From: Zeshi Luo Date: Thu, 28 Oct 2021 12:34:36 +0800 Subject: [PATCH 3/5] addclikustosupportautogenfiles --- .../synapse/resource-manager/readme.az.md | 139 ++++++++++++++++++ .../synapse/resource-manager/readme.cli.md | 9 ++ 2 files changed, 148 insertions(+) create mode 100644 specification/synapse/resource-manager/readme.az.md create mode 100644 specification/synapse/resource-manager/readme.cli.md diff --git a/specification/synapse/resource-manager/readme.az.md b/specification/synapse/resource-manager/readme.az.md new file mode 100644 index 000000000000..fb4d40977774 --- /dev/null +++ b/specification/synapse/resource-manager/readme.az.md @@ -0,0 +1,139 @@ +## AZ +These settings apply only when `--az` is specified on the command line. + +``` yaml $(az) && $(target-mode) == 'core' +az: + extensions: synapse + namespace: azure.mgmt.synapse + package-name: azure-mgmt-synapse +az-output-folder: $(azure-cli-folder)/src/azure-cli/azure/cli/command_modules/synapse +python-sdk-output-folder: "$(az-output-folder)/vendored_sdks/synapse" +input-file: + - Microsoft.Synapse/preview/2021-06-01-preview/kustoPool.json + +directive: + - where: + group: 'synapse kusto-pool-database-principal-assignment' + set: + group: 'synapse kusto database-principal-assignment' + - where: + group: 'synapse kusto-pool-attached-database-configuration' + set: + group: 'synapse kusto attached-database-configuration' + - where: + group: 'synapse kusto-pool-data-connection' + set: + group: 'synapse kusto data-connection' + - where: + group: 'synapse kusto-pool-database' + set: + group: 'synapse kusto database' + - where: + group: 'synapse kusto-pool-principal-assignment' + set: + group: 'synapse kusto pool-principal-assignment' + - where: + group: 'synapse kusto-pool' + set: + group: 'synapse kusto pool' + - where: + group: 'synapse kusto-pool-data-connection event-grid' + set: + group: 'synapse kusto data-connection event-grid' + - where: + group: 'synapse kusto-pool-data-connection event-hub' + set: + group: 'synapse kusto data-connection event-hub' + - where: + group: 'synapse kusto-pool-data-connection iot-hub' + set: + group: 'synapse kusto data-connection iot-hub' + +cli: + cli-directive: + - where: + group: 'KustoPoolDataConnections' + param: 'blobStorageEventType' + alias: + - blob_storage_event_type + - bset + - where: + group: 'KustoPoolDataConnections' + param: 'storageAccountResourceId' + alias: + - storage_account_resource_id + - sari + - where: + group: 'KustoPoolDataConnections' + param: 'eventSystemProperties' + alias: + - event_system_properties + - esysp + - where: + group: 'KustoPoolDataConnections' + param: 'managedIdentityResourceId' + alias: + - managed_identity_resource_id + - miri + - where: + group: 'KustoPoolDataConnections' + param: 'sharedAccessPolicyName' + alias: + - shared_access_policy_name + - sapn + - where: + group: 'KustoPoolDatabasePrincipalAssignments|KustoPoolPrincipalAssignments' + param: 'principalAssignmentName' + alias: + - principal_assignment_name + - psn + - where: + group: 'KustoPool' + param: 'enableStreamingIngest' + alias: + - enable_streaming_ingest + - esig + - where: + group: 'KustoPoolAttachedDatabaseConfigurations' + param: 'attachedDatabaseConfigurationName' + alias: + - attached_database_configuration_name + - adcn + - where: + group: 'KustoPoolAttachedDatabaseConfigurations' + param: 'defaultPrincipalsModificationKind' + alias: + - default_principals_modification_kind + - dpmk + - where: + group: 'KustoPoolAttachedDatabaseConfigurations' + param: 'tableLevelSharingProperties' + alias: + - table_level_sharing_properties + - tlsp + - where: + group: 'KustoPoolDataConnections' + op: 'CreateOrUpdate|Update' + param: 'parameters' + poly-resource: true + - where: + group: 'KustoPoolDataConnections' + op: 'dataConnectionValidation' + removed: true + - where: + group: 'KustoPools' + op: 'AddLanguageExtensions' + removed: true + - where: + group: 'KustoPools' + op: 'RemoveLanguageExtensions' + removed: true + - where: + group: 'KustoPools' + op: 'DetachFollowerDatabases' + removed: true + - where: + group: 'KustoPools' + op: 'CreateOrUpdate|Update' + removed: true +``` diff --git a/specification/synapse/resource-manager/readme.cli.md b/specification/synapse/resource-manager/readme.cli.md new file mode 100644 index 000000000000..24ad12dd438b --- /dev/null +++ b/specification/synapse/resource-manager/readme.cli.md @@ -0,0 +1,9 @@ + +# Az.Synapse +This directory contains the Cli common model for the Synapse service. + +> Metadata +``` yaml +# Migrated from Powershell's readme + +``` \ No newline at end of file From 69a50300781e7573bcd3c73cdb5acd42f7f98e8d Mon Sep 17 00:00:00 2001 From: Zeshi Luo Date: Tue, 2 Nov 2021 13:37:54 +0800 Subject: [PATCH 4/5] removealias --- .../synapse/resource-manager/readme.az.md | 60 ------------------- .../synapse/resource-manager/readme.cli.md | 1 - 2 files changed, 61 deletions(-) diff --git a/specification/synapse/resource-manager/readme.az.md b/specification/synapse/resource-manager/readme.az.md index fb4d40977774..19278fdc219c 100644 --- a/specification/synapse/resource-manager/readme.az.md +++ b/specification/synapse/resource-manager/readme.az.md @@ -51,66 +51,6 @@ directive: cli: cli-directive: - - where: - group: 'KustoPoolDataConnections' - param: 'blobStorageEventType' - alias: - - blob_storage_event_type - - bset - - where: - group: 'KustoPoolDataConnections' - param: 'storageAccountResourceId' - alias: - - storage_account_resource_id - - sari - - where: - group: 'KustoPoolDataConnections' - param: 'eventSystemProperties' - alias: - - event_system_properties - - esysp - - where: - group: 'KustoPoolDataConnections' - param: 'managedIdentityResourceId' - alias: - - managed_identity_resource_id - - miri - - where: - group: 'KustoPoolDataConnections' - param: 'sharedAccessPolicyName' - alias: - - shared_access_policy_name - - sapn - - where: - group: 'KustoPoolDatabasePrincipalAssignments|KustoPoolPrincipalAssignments' - param: 'principalAssignmentName' - alias: - - principal_assignment_name - - psn - - where: - group: 'KustoPool' - param: 'enableStreamingIngest' - alias: - - enable_streaming_ingest - - esig - - where: - group: 'KustoPoolAttachedDatabaseConfigurations' - param: 'attachedDatabaseConfigurationName' - alias: - - attached_database_configuration_name - - adcn - - where: - group: 'KustoPoolAttachedDatabaseConfigurations' - param: 'defaultPrincipalsModificationKind' - alias: - - default_principals_modification_kind - - dpmk - - where: - group: 'KustoPoolAttachedDatabaseConfigurations' - param: 'tableLevelSharingProperties' - alias: - - table_level_sharing_properties - - tlsp - where: group: 'KustoPoolDataConnections' op: 'CreateOrUpdate|Update' diff --git a/specification/synapse/resource-manager/readme.cli.md b/specification/synapse/resource-manager/readme.cli.md index 24ad12dd438b..b1af69aadfef 100644 --- a/specification/synapse/resource-manager/readme.cli.md +++ b/specification/synapse/resource-manager/readme.cli.md @@ -4,6 +4,5 @@ This directory contains the Cli common model for the Synapse service. > Metadata ``` yaml -# Migrated from Powershell's readme ``` \ No newline at end of file From 5bbd349296759ddacbce6174a9d92ff9c47bb1a0 Mon Sep 17 00:00:00 2001 From: Zeshi Luo Date: Tue, 2 Nov 2021 18:53:35 +0800 Subject: [PATCH 5/5] addrepo --- specification/synapse/resource-manager/readme.md | 1 + 1 file changed, 1 insertion(+) diff --git a/specification/synapse/resource-manager/readme.md b/specification/synapse/resource-manager/readme.md index 36e2693476ea..a7d1337fe8e0 100644 --- a/specification/synapse/resource-manager/readme.md +++ b/specification/synapse/resource-manager/readme.md @@ -358,6 +358,7 @@ swagger-to-sdk: - repo: azure-sdk-for-python-track2 - repo: azure-sdk-for-go - repo: azure-resource-manager-schemas + - repo: azure-cli-extensions ``` ## Python